#57f914 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#57f914 is composed of 34.1% red, 97.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 92%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102.4 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 52.7%. #57f914 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eff28 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

Shades and Tints of #57f914

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e00 is the darkest color, while #fbf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#57f914

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858a83 is the less saturated color, while #57f914 is the most saturated one.
